Transaction ca0395b95146ca3b4ef92123d3552d29871cb3896c45a69925ea0cae68449dec
3 Input
2 Outputs
- ca0395b95146ca3b4ef92123d3552d29871cb3896c45a69925ea0cae68449dec:0
- ca0395b95146ca3b4ef92123d3552d29871cb3896c45a69925ea0cae68449dec:1
value 404915
address 1AwBHi7cCB87KiaeMDz5LcDawqgyfFfURf
value 4311443
address 127gaoNuNJoV1V2D6ea7bNVcAwgApBKJo4